What is covered in the Idaho motorcycle handbook?
The Idaho motorcycle handbook covers motorcycle controls and equipment, riding techniques, defensive riding strategies, intersections and turning, carrying passengers and cargo, special riding conditions (rain, night, highways), and Idaho-specific traffic laws for motorcyclists.
Do I need a separate license to ride a motorcycle in Idaho?
Yes. Idaho requires a motorcycle endorsement (M) or separate motorcycle license to legally ride on public roads. You must pass both a written knowledge test and a skills test (or complete an approved safety course).
How many questions are on the Idaho motorcycle written test?
The Idaho (ID) motorcycle knowledge test typically has 25–30 multiple-choice questions covering motorcycle laws and safe riding practices. A passing score is usually 80% or higher.
Can I take a motorcycle safety course instead of the written test in Idaho?
Many states allow you to waive the written and/or skills test by completing an approved MSF (Motorcycle Safety Foundation) Basic RiderCourse. Check with the Idaho DMV for current requirements.
